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ked shredded chicken (rotisserie chicken works great)
  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up shredded cheddar or Mexican blend cheese
  • ¼ cup salsa (mild or spicy)
  • ½ tsp garlic powder
  • ½ tsp chili powder
  • ½ tsp cumin
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 8 small flour or corn tortillas
  • Cooking spray or oil (for brushing)
  • Chopped cilantro
  • Sour cream
  • Guacamole
  • Extra shredded cheese

Each ingredient plays a crucial role in crafting the perfect taquito. The chicken provides the main protein, while cream cheese adds a creamy richness that complements the spices. You can substitute turkey or any preferred protein if needed. The salsa adds moisture and flavor, and the spices enhance the overall taste. Quality tortillas are key; opt for freshly made if possible.

Directions

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and prepare a baking sheet by lining it with parchment paper or lightly greasing it to prevent sticking.

  1. In a large bowl, combine the cooked shredded chicken, softened cream cheese, shredded cheese, salsa, garlic powder, chili powder, cumin, salt, and pepper. Mix thoroughly until blended well.

  2. Warm the tortillas in the microwave for about 20 seconds to make them pliable. This step is crucial to prevent cracking when you roll them up.

  3. Spoon 2-3 tablespoons of the filling onto one side of each tortilla and roll tightly, ensuring the filling is secure within the tortilla.

  4. Place the rolled taquitos seam-side down on the prepared baking sheet, spacing them apart for even cooking.

  5. Lightly brush each taquito with oil or spray with cooking spray to promote crispiness during baking.

  6. Bake for 15-20 minutes or until they turn golden brown and crispy.

  7. To achieve extra crispiness, you can broil them for 1-2 minutes at the end.

  8. Serve warm with sour cream, guacamole, or your favorite toppings.

how to store Crispy Chicken Taquitos

Storing your Crispy Chicken Taquitos properly is essential to maintain freshness. If you have leftovers, allow them to cool completely before storing them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They can stay fresh for up to 3 days.

For longer storage, consider freezing them. Place the cooled, rolled taquitos in a single layer on a baking sheet and freeze until solid. Transfer them to an airtight container or freezer bag. They will last for up to 2 months. When you’re ready to enjoy them again, bake from frozen at 425°F (220°C) for about 20-25 minutes.

When reheating, avoid the microwave if possible, as this can make them soggy. Instead, reheat them in the oven to retain their crisp texture.

tips to make Crispy Chicken Taquitos

To ensure that you achieve the best results, here are some simple tips to enhance your taquitos. Always ensure your tortillas are warmed to avoid tearing, as mentioned previously. For added flavor and texture, consider adding finely chopped onions or black beans to the filling.

Experimenting with different cheeses can also yield delightful results. A combination of Monterey Jack and Pepper Jack can introduce a nice kick. If you’re craving additional heat, feel free to add more chili powder or include chopped jalapeños in the filling.

For a healthier option, you can bake the taquitos instead of frying, which results in a crisp exterior without added oil. Finally, remember to serve them with a variety of dips; this will make the experience more enjoyable for everyone.

variation

Crispy Chicken Taquitos can be easily modified to suit your taste or dietary preferences. Here are a few creative variations you can try:

  1. Spicy Chicken Taquitos: Mix in diced j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ce with the filling for those who enjoy extra heat.

  2. Vegetarian Taquitos: Substitute shredded chicken with roasted vegetables, black beans, and cheese for a meatless option.

  3. BBQ Chicken Taquitos: Combine shredded chicken with your favorite barbecue sauce for a sweet and tangy flavor twist.

  4. Cheesy Spinach and Chicken Taquitos: Add some fresh spinach and an extra layer of cheese into the filling for a creamy green touch.

Each of these variations adds a unique flair to the traditional recipe, enhancing your taquito experience.

FAQs

1. Can I prepare Crispy Chicken Taquitos 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the taquitos and store them in the refrigerator before baking. Just remember to cover them tightly to prevent them from drying out.

2. Can I fry the taquitos instead of baking them?
Absolutely! If you prefer a traditional crunchy texture, fry them in hot oil until golden brown. However, baked taquitos are healthier and easier to manage.

3. What dipping sauces pair well with taquitos?
Sour cream, guacamole, and salsa are classic dipping sauces. You can also try queso dip or sriracha mayo for an exciting twist.
